BROOKLYN PARK, Minn. — The Maine Gladiators suffered their first loss at USA Hockey’s Tier II 2A 18U National Tournament on Friday as the Montgomery Ice Devils came away with a 4-0 victory.

Ethan Birndorf and Seamus McNally gave Montgomery (2-0) a 2-0 lead after the first period.

Connor Hall scored midway through the second period, giving the Maryland-based Ice Devils a 3-0 advantage. Samuel Greenberg capped the scoring with 5:38 remaining in the second stanza.

Jason Conlon made 14 saves in two periods for Montgomery and Devin Brown held off the Auburn-based Gladiators (1-1) with 13 saves in the third period to complete the combined shutout.

Edward Little’s Gage Ducharme made 23 saves in the loss.

The Gladiators wrap up pool play Saturday at 3:15 p.m. against the Clearwater (Florida) Ice Storm’s Blue team.
